Concentrated solar water heater-cum-distillation unit, having capacity of 70 l was developed. Refractive type Fresnel lens was used as solar concentrator along with a copper plate as an absorber. The developed system was tested for its technical as well as economic feasibility of solar water heating and distillation units. Overall efficiency of the solar water heater was 42.38 percent. The yield of distilled water was 4.72 kg.m−2.day−1 and efficiency of the distillation unit was 28.78 per cent. The solar water heater coupled with distillation unit performed well. Total cost of the unit was Rs.7,524. The payback period was 2 years with benefit-cost ratio of 2.64.
